WebMay 16, 2024 · By Morgan May 16, 2024. Looking for the best ways to keep sugar fresh for everyday, short term and long term food storage? Check out the below information! Everyday – store in an airtight container, keep away from moisture, use as needed. Short term – store in an airtight container, food grade bucket or mylar bag with NO oxygen absorber. Raw potatoes that have been cut should be stored in a bowl of cold water and refrigerated. They'll be good for the next 24 hours.
